Chapter 462: LV4

Hearing Zhang Yi’s words, Bian Junwu suddenly chuckled.

“Oh? Do you think my understanding is incorrect?” Zhang Yi asked.

Bian Junwu shook his head. “There are indeed so nuances. The so-called classification of superhuman abilities doesn’t directly correlate with combat strength.

“What it represents more is the potential ceiling of one’s ability.

“Superpowers vary greatly—not all are combat-oriented. So are auxiliary or fall under entirely different categories.

“If an ability is countered or the environnt isn’t favorable, it’s not unusual for a higher-level superhuman to be defeated by one ranked lower.”

Zhang Yi nodded in agreent.

If superpowers were akin to weapons, then their effectiveness depended on the wielder's skill and the circumstances.

“So,” Zhang Yi said with a smirk, “you’re saying I’m a Delta-level superhuman, or LV4? That ans we’re the sa rank. You sure have a high opinion of !”

Taking a sip of tea, Zhang Yi began calculating in his mind.

Bian Junwu had no reason to deliberately mislead him, so there were two possibilities for his claim that they were on the sa level.

First, despite Bian Junwu’s imnse strength, his abilities might have significant drawbacks. Otherwise, his destructive power would far exceed anything Zhang Yi could currently match. Of course, in terms of defense, that might be a different story.

Second, Bian Junwu recognized the potential of Zhang Yi’s spatial abilities.

Spatial powers weren’t purely combat-oriented, but their versatility was undeniably formidable. Combining offense, defense, and logistical utility, such abilities could justify a Delta-level rating.

Bian Junwu elaborated, “My assessnt of you is based on what I’ve observed. Official evaluations are conducted by professionals in the major districts.

“These rankings aren’t absolute and depend on demonstrated abilities.

“From my experience, I’d categorize you as Delta-level.

“Keep in mind, advancing to the next level is always possible for superhumans, but Delta represents a critical threshold. Without the ability to ‘Assimilate’ other energies, a superhuman can’t progress beyond LV3.”

As Bian Junwu explained, Zhang Yi gained a clearer understanding of superhuman classifications.

For now, Bian Junwu’s judgnt placed his potential at Delta, or LV4—a level brimming with possibilities but not necessarily indicative of sheer combat power.

Despite this, Zhang Yi couldn’t help but grow curious about the enigmatic LV5, the Epsilon-level superhumans.

How strong were they?

Had such individuals already erged in this world?

Unable to resist his curiosity, Zhang Yi asked, “Mr. Bian, have you ever seen an Epsilon-level superhuman?”

Bian Junwu slowly shook his head. “I haven’t.”

Zhang Yi was about to comnt on the disappointnt when Bian Junwu added, “But I know for a fact that there’s an Epsilon-level superhuman in the Shengjing District.”

Zhang Yi’s eyes lit up.

“There’s really soone like that?”

As a superhuman, Zhang Yi couldn’t help but feel intrigued by such an existence.

Bian Junwu chuckled. “It’s not exactly a secret.

“The major districts, tasked with managing vast territories in the apocalypse, rely on absolute power to suppress mutant creatures and lawless groups.

“Such overwhelming force is necessary.”

When ntioning the Epsilon-level superhuman, Bian Junwu’s eyes glead with admiration and envy.

“That individual’s power has reached a level that defies logic.

“They say anyone targeted by them, no matter the distance, can be killed with a single thought. That’s true divinity.”

Zhang Yi nearly dropped his teacup. His eyes widened in disbelief as he stared at Bian Junwu.

“You… You’re joking, right? Killing soone from a thousand miles away? What are they, a satellite-guided missile?”

Bian Junwu smirked and gazed out at the snowy landscape.

“It’s far more convenient than that. From what I’ve heard, there’s no escape for anyone marked by them, no matter where they hide.”

Zhang Yi rubbed his temples, feeling overwheld.

“This sounds more like taphysics than science!”

Bian Junwu said calmly, “The universe is filled with mysteries. Even the divine rolls dice. The world’s unpredictability is no surprise.

“In theory, there’s one more level beyond Epsilon: the legendary LV6, Oga-level superhumans.

“This classification exists only in theory, as no such superhuman has ever appeared. It refers to individuals with infinite growth potential and no upper limit to their strength.

“At that level, they would truly be gods…”

Bian Junwu’s words trailed off as he suddenly leaned on the table with one hand, covering his mouth with the other, and began coughing violently.

The force of his coughs made the table shake, spilling water from their glasses.

Instinctively, Zhang Yi slid his chair back half a step and asked, “Captain Bian, are you okay? Should I call a doctor?”

Bian Junwu finally stopped coughing after so ti. Wiping a trace of blood from the corner of his mouth, he spoke nonchalantly.

“No need. It’s just an old condition.”

Noticing Zhang Yi’s curious expression, Bian Junwu remarked flatly, “I have a terminal illness and only a short ti left to live.”

He spoke so matter-of-factly that it sounded like he was describing soone else’s situation.

“If not for this, I wouldn’t have volunteered to lead this team and deal with such troubleso matters.”

Zhang Yi’s suspicions were confird.

As he suspected, Bian Junwu’s body had significant issues.

Was it a natural illness, a side effect of his abilities, or the result of being artificially modified, like the cyborgs at West Hill Base?

Speculation churned in Zhang Yi’s mind, but he refrained from prying further, as such details likely involved Jiangnan District’s classified information.

Instead, he offered comfort.

“With today’s advanced dicine, even cancer can be cured. Surely there’s nothing that can’t be treated.”

“My family doctor was a lead physician at Tianhai City’s First People’s Hospital. Perhaps she could examine you?”

Bian Junwu’s face remained impassive as he let Zhang Yi finish before responding.

“There’s no need to probe. I’m a dying man. I took on this mission to ensure that, after my death, my wife and children could live better lives.”

As he spoke, he removed his signature sunglasses, revealing a face even paler than before.

His eyes were eerily gray, devoid of pupils, filled with a lifeless hue.

“My ability cos at the cost of my vision and health. That’s why it’s limited to Delta-level.

“Otherwise, with more ti, I might have reached Epsilon-level myself.

“Unfortunately, its fatal flaws make a superweapon with limited uses. Do you understand now?”

Zhang Yi’s suspicions were confird. Bian Junwu’s ability not only consud his vitality but also drastically shortened his lifespan.

After a mont of silence, Zhang Yi sighed softly.

“I see. But I didn’t expect you to share the details of your ability so openly with .”
